Liverpool Central Station is equipped to meet a variety of passenger needs. The ticket office operates from early morning until late at night, ensuring travelers can purchase or collect tickets conveniently. Ticket machines are available but do note that they are not designed for accessible use. For those utilizing smartcards, issuance is possible at the station, although validators are not currently available.
Accessibility is a prime focus at Liverpool Central, ensuring step-free access throughout the station. While there are no dedicated parking facilities, visitors can take advantage of accessible toilets and waiting areas. Staff assistance is readily available every day of the week for those who need it, adding an extra layer of support for all passengers.
The station features several refreshment and shopping options. Whether you need to grab a quick bite from a vending machine or pick up some essentials from the variety of shops housed on site, such as a convenience store or even a shoe repair service, Liverpool Central has got you covered. An ATM is also available for any immediate cash needs.
Navigating to and from Liverpool Central is straightforward. Rail replacement services, if needed, can be found at 32 Great Charlotte Street, just moments away from the station. For local travels, comprehensive bus routes are available, with detailed travel information provided by Merseytravel or by contacting Traveline.
For those needing to reach Liverpool John Lennon Airport, there's a convenient rail/bus ticket option from any Merseyrail station to the airport, courtesy of the 86A or 80A buses departing from Liverpool South Parkway station, arriving at the airport within a short 10-minute ride.

Cardiff Queen Street station is equipped with everything you need for a comfortable and accessible travel experience. The ticket office operates from as early as 6 am on weekdays and has plenty of ticket machines available throughout the station. You can collect tickets bought online from these machines and they're easily accessible near the main entrance. The station offers step-free access across all platforms via lifts, making it highly accessible. Accessible toilets and baby changing facilities are conveniently located on Platform 4 for those traveling with little ones.
For those who might need extra assistance, staff is available to help from 05:15 to midnight on most days. Despite the lack of eateries or shops, the station offers public Wi-Fi so you can stay connected on the go. If cycling is your preferred mode to and from the station, you'll find ample cycle storage with CCTV coverage for peace of mind. Remember, the bustling streets of Cardiff offer numerous nearby cafes and shops to grab a bite or essentials before you catch your train.
Getting to and from Cardiff Queen Street is a breeze with several options available. There are local bus services with limited offerings right outside the station on weekdays. During rail disruptions, replacement bus services are set up at bus stops nearby, ensuring you aren't left stranded. However, taxis aren't as readily accessible since there are no designated accessible taxi points or spaces.
